Overview

MSP430F5418IPNR from Texas Instruments is an ultra-low-power 16-bit RISC microcontroller with 128 KB Flash, 16 KB RAM, 12-bit ADC (14 external + 2 internal channels), three 16-bit timers (TA0/TA1/TB0), two USCI_A and two USCI_B modules (UART/IrDA/SPI/I²C), and integrated real-time clock. It operates from 2.2 V to 3.6 V and targets battery-powered sensor systems and digital timers.

Technical Context

The MSP430F5418IPNR implements a unified clock system (UCS) with FLL-based frequency stabilization, programmable LDO core regulation, and five low-power modes (LPM0–LPM4). Its CPUXV2 core supports 18-MHz operation and executes instructions in single-cycle or two-cycle latency depending on addressing mode.

Peripherals are memory-mapped and interrupt-driven: the 12-bit ADC12_A module supports autoscan across 16 channels with internal reference and sample-and-hold; DMA transfers support three-channel burst or single-mode transfers between peripherals and memory without CPU intervention.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Core Architecture 16-bit RISC CPUXV2 with constant generators and 18-MHz max system clock - enables high code efficiency and deterministic real-time response.
Memory 128 KB Flash / 16 KB RAM - sufficient for complex sensor fusion algorithms and firmware updates in field-deployed devices.
ADC 12-bit ADC12_A with 14 external + 2 internal channels, 200 ksps max sampling rate - supports simultaneous multi-sensor analog acquisition with built-in temperature sensor.
Low-Power Modes LPM3 (2.6 µA @ 3.0 V, RTC active) and LPM4 (1.69 µA @ 3.0 V) - enables >10-year battery life in metering and remote monitoring applications.
Communication 2 × USCI_A (UART/IrDA/SPI) + 2 × USCI_B (I²C/SPI) - provides dual-protocol serial connectivity for sensor hubs and host MCU interfacing.
Timers Timer_A0 (5 CC registers), Timer_A1 (3 CC registers), Timer_B0 (7 CC shadow registers) - supports PWM generation, input capture, and time-stamped event logging.
Package LQFP-80 (12 mm × 12 mm) with 67 I/O pins - compatible with standard PCB assembly processes and offers routing flexibility for mixed-signal layouts.

Pinout & Package

LQFP-80 package (12 mm × 12 mm, 0.5 mm pitch), 67 general-purpose I/O pins, 3 power domains (DVCC/DVSS, AVCC/AVSS, VCORE), and dedicated crystal oscillator pins (XIN/XOUT).

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
P1.0/TA0CLK/ACLK Timer/CLK I/O Configurable as TA0 clock source or ACLK output (divided by 1–32) - enables precise timer synchronization and low-frequency system clock distribution.
P2.4/RTCCLK RTC Output Real-time clock signal output - drives external timing circuits or wake-up triggers for periodic low-power polling.
P2.7/ADC12CLK/DMAE0 ADC Clock / DMA Trigger Provides conversion clock to ADC12_A or acts as external DMA trigger - allows hardware-synchronized sampling and zero-CPU-overhead data movement.
P3.0/UCB0STE/UCA0CLK USCI SPI Control Slave transmit enable (USCI_B0) or SPI clock (USCI_A0 master) - enables daisy-chained SPI sensor networks or dual-role peripheral interfacing.
P4.0–P4.6/TB0.0–TB0.6 Timer_B Capture/Compare Seven independent capture/compare channels - supports multi-phase motor control, LED dimming, or pulse-width measurement with shadow register buffering.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Unified Clock System (UCS) FLL stabilization with XT1 (32 kHz), XT2 (up to 32 MHz), REFO (32.768 kHz), and VLO (10 kHz) sources - eliminates need for external clock ICs and reduces BOM count.
Low-Power Oscillator (VLO) 10 kHz internal RC oscillator active in LPM3/LPM4 - enables RTC operation and fast wake-up (<5 µs) without external crystal, lowering system cost and board space.
Hardware Multiplier (MPY32) 32-bit signed/unsigned multiply in one cycle - accelerates FIR filtering, PID computation, and cryptographic operations in sensor preprocessing firmware.
Integrated Power Management Programmable LDO core regulator with SVS/SVM brownout detection - ensures stable operation across battery discharge curves and prevents erratic behavior during voltage sag.
Serial Onboard Programming No external programming voltage required - simplifies production programming and field firmware updates via UART or Spy-Bi-Wire interface.

FAQ

What is the maximum operating frequency of the MSP430F5418IPNR?

The MSP430F5418IPNR supports a maximum system clock frequency of 18 MHz, achieved via its digitally controlled oscillator (DCO) stabilized by the FLL loop using external crystals (XT2 up to 32 MHz) or internal references. This frequency enables real-time signal processing while maintaining sub-µA standby current in LPM3 mode.

Does the MSP430F5418IPNR include a hardware real-time clock (RTC)?

Yes, the MSP430F5418IPNR integrates a full-featured RTC_A module with calendar mode, alarm interrupts, and battery-backed operation. It can run from the 32-kHz crystal (XIN/XOUT) or internal VLO in LPM3, consuming only 2.6 µA at 3.0 V - making it ideal for time-stamped data logging in energy-constrained devices.

How many ADC channels does the MSP430F5418IPNR support, and what types are they?

The MSP430F5418IPNR features the ADC12_A module with 16 total channels: 14 external analog inputs (A0–A15, excluding A10/A11) and 2 internal channels (temperature sensor and VREF/2). All channels support autoscan mode, enabling unattended multi-sensor acquisition with configurable sample-and-hold timing.

What communication interfaces are available on the MSP430F5418IPNR?

The MSP430F5418IPNR provides four universal serial communication interfaces: USCI_A0 and USCI_A1 (each supporting UART, IrDA, and SPI), and USCI_B0 and USCI_B1 (each supporting I²C and SPI). This dual-A/dual-B configuration allows concurrent UART debugging, I²C sensor bus, and SPI flash memory access without resource conflict.

Is the MSP430F5418IPNR pin-compatible with other devices in the MSP430F54xx family?

Yes, the MSP430F5418IPNR in the 80-pin LQFP (PN) package shares identical pinout with MSP430F5437IPN and MSP430F5435IPN. This allows direct substitution within the same footprint when upgrading Flash size or adjusting peripheral count, provided firmware accommodates differences in USCI count and memory map.
